There’s something wonderfully nostalgic about a steaming bowl of Cabbage Soup with Ground Beef — the kind that fills your kitchen with that homey, hearty aroma that says, “You’re right where you’re supposed to be.”
I first fell in love with this recipe on one of those chilly Texas evenings when my kids were begging for something “warm and meaty but not boring.” I glanced at a humble head of cabbage in my fridge and thought, challenge accepted. The result? A cozy, flavor-packed soup that’s now a family favorite — simple enough for weeknights, but rich enough to feel special.
This soup is more than just dinner; it’s a bowl of comfort, packed with tender beef, chunky vegetables, and a savory broth that tastes like it simmered all day (even though it only takes about an hour).
Table of Contents
Why You’ll Love This Cabbage Soup with Ground Beef Recipe
- One-pot magic: Less cleanup, more flavor. Everything comes together in a single Dutch oven.
- Nutritious and filling: Packed with cabbage, carrots, celery, and lean protein — it’s hearty without being heavy.
- Budget-friendly: A big batch of this feeds a crowd for just a few dollars per serving.
- Freezer-friendly: Perfect for meal prep or for those “what’s for dinner?” emergencies.
- Customizable: Swap beef for ground turkey or chicken if you prefer something lighter.
If you love one-pot meals like my Creamy Chicken Parmesan Soup or Crock-Pot Hamburger Potato Soup, you’ll adore this one too.
What Does Cabbage Soup with Ground Beef Taste Like?
Imagine the cozy flavors of a classic beef stew, but lighter, brighter, and loaded with texture. The cabbage becomes silky-tender, the carrots slightly sweet, and the broth rich with tomato and beef essence. Every spoonful feels like a warm hug on a cold day — or, if you’re like me, even a rainy summer afternoon.
The Cajun seasoning adds a little depth (and optional heat), while the tomato paste gives it that slow-cooked flavor shortcut. It’s comfort food that doesn’t weigh you down — proof that wholesome can still taste indulgent.
Ingredients for Cabbage Soup with Ground Beef Recipe
When you’re gathering ingredients, think simple, honest, pantry staples. That’s the beauty of this recipe — you probably already have most of these at home.
- 1 lb ground beef – I like 85/15 for just the right richness. Swap with ground turkey or venison if you’d like.
- 1 small yellow onion, diced – the aromatic base of any good soup.
- 1 small green bell pepper, diced – adds freshness and a pop of color.
- 2 carrots, sliced – sweet and earthy balance.
- 2 ribs celery, sliced – for that classic soup depth.
- 4 cloves garlic, minced – because no soup should be without it.
- 2 tbsp garlic and herb seasoning – flavor foundation.
- 1 tsp Cajun seasoning (optional) – adds a subtle kick.
- 2 tbsp tomato paste – rich, umami depth.
- 2 medium russet potatoes, peeled and chopped – they soak up the broth beautifully.
- 2 cans (14.5 oz each) diced tomatoes – I love the basil, garlic & oregano kind.
- 1 head green cabbage, chopped – the star of the show.
- 1 tbsp beef bouillon (like Knorr) mixed with 4 cups water, or use 4 cups broth.
- Salt and pepper, to taste.
Pro tip: If you want a deeper flavor, try browning your tomato paste slightly before adding the liquids — it adds a subtle caramel note that’s pure magic.
If you enjoy this hearty soup, check out my Cabbage Roll Soup Recipe — it’s like this one’s more indulgent cousin!

How to Make Cabbage Soup with Ground Beef (Step-by-Step)
Let’s dive into the heart of this dish — the part where your kitchen starts to smell like home. If you’ve ever made one of my other soups, like the Creamy Tomato Orzo Soup with Mini Turkey Meatballs or the Crock-Pot Hamburger Potato Soup, you’ll already know how much I love layering flavor. This Cabbage Soup with Ground Beef Recipe is no different — it’s all about building depth, texture, and comfort in every spoonful.
Here’s your detailed step-by-step guide to success:
Step 1: Brown the Beef — The Flavor Foundation
Start with a large Dutch oven or a heavy-bottomed soup pot. Set it over medium heat and add your ground beef. As it cooks, use a wooden spoon to break it into small crumbles. This is where your first layer of flavor begins — those browned bits clinging to the bottom (called fond) are pure gold.
If you’re using a leaner meat like ground turkey or venison, drizzle in a tablespoon of olive oil for richness. Cook until the beef is no longer pink and slightly crisp around the edges. Don’t rush this step — it takes about 7–10 minutes, but it’s worth every second.
Once browned, you can drain off a bit of the fat if needed, but I like to leave just a touch. It’s what makes this Cabbage Soup with Ground Beef taste like it’s been simmering for hours.
Step 2: Sauté the Veggies — Build the Aroma
Add in your diced onion, green bell pepper, carrots, and celery. Stir and let them mingle with the beef. This combo creates that cozy, soup-shop aroma we all love.
Sprinkle in the garlic and herb seasoning and Cajun spice (if you like a little heat). Stir everything together until the vegetables begin to soften — about 5 minutes. This is the perfect moment to close your eyes and breathe in. It’s that “grandma’s kitchen on a Sunday afternoon” kind of smell.
For more veggie-based inspiration, check out my High Protein Vegetable Soup. It uses a similar base that makes any soup burst with color and flavor.
Step 3: Stir in the Tomato Paste — The Secret Weapon
Now, add two tablespoons of tomato paste straight into the pot. Stir and let it cook for about 2–3 minutes. What you’re doing here is caramelizing the paste — it deepens the flavor and adds a slightly sweet, roasted note to your broth.
This simple trick turns an ordinary Cabbage Soup with Ground Beef Recipe into something truly restaurant-worthy.
Step 4: Add the Potatoes and Tomatoes
Toss in the chopped potatoes and pour in two cans of diced tomatoes (preferably with basil, garlic, and oregano). The tomatoes add tang and brightness, balancing the richness of the beef. Stir everything well to coat the veggies and meat evenly.
At this stage, it’s already starting to look hearty and beautiful — a colorful pot that could easily feed a small army.
Step 5: Add the Cabbage — The Star of the Show
Here’s where the magic happens. Gradually add your chopped cabbage to the pot. It may seem like too much at first, but trust me — cabbage wilts down as it cooks. Add a handful, stir, let it soften, then add more.
The cabbage not only bulks up the soup but also gives it that tender, silky texture that melts into every bite. It’s the soul of this Cabbage Soup with Ground Beef Recipe — hearty, rustic, and full of character.
Step 6: Pour in the Broth and Simmer
Mix your beef bouillon with 4 cups of hot water, or use a good-quality beef or chicken broth. Pour it into the pot, making sure everything is covered.
Now turn up the heat and bring your soup to a rolling boil. Once it’s bubbling, reduce to low heat, cover, and let it simmer gently for about 30 minutes.
As it cooks, your potatoes will become fork-tender, the cabbage will soften, and all those flavors will marry into something downright magical. You can almost taste the comfort just from the aroma.
Step 7: Taste, Adjust, and Serve
After simmering, lift the lid and take a deep breath. That’s the smell of dinner done right. Give your soup a taste — add salt and black pepper as needed. If you like a bolder broth, stir in another pinch of garlic and herb seasoning or even a splash of Worcestershire sauce.
Ladle the soup into big bowls, garnish with a sprinkle of parsley, and serve hot with a slice of crusty bread or a buttered biscuit.
For extra cozy vibes, pair this with my Loaded Chicken and Biscuit Bake — the contrast between the creamy bake and this vibrant soup is absolutely dreamy.
Step 8: Let It Rest (Optional but Recommended)
If you have the patience, let the soup rest for about 10 minutes off the heat before serving. This allows the flavors to blend even more deeply. In fact, I often make my Cabbage Soup with Ground Beef Recipe a day ahead because, like most soups, it tastes even better the next day.
Final Thoughts on the Process
This Cabbage Soup with Ground Beef Recipe is simple enough for busy weeknights yet special enough for weekend family dinners. Each step — from browning the beef to simmering the cabbage — is designed to create layers of flavor that feel familiar but still exciting.
Cooking it is as comforting as eating it. The gentle simmer, the bubbling pot, the way the cabbage softens right before your eyes — it’s all part of the joy.
And when your family gathers around the table, spoons clinking, smiles forming — that’s when you’ll know you’ve made something truly special.
Tips and Tricks for Perfect Cabbage Soup with Ground Beef
- Add a squeeze of lemon before serving for a fresh, bright finish.
- Want a thicker texture? Mash a few potatoes in the pot or simmer uncovered for 10 extra minutes.
- Make it low-carb: Skip the potatoes and add extra cabbage or zucchini.
- Freeze it: Cools beautifully and freezes up to 3 months.
- For a smoky twist: Add a dash of smoked paprika or a spoonful of fire-roasted tomatoes.
Storage: How to Keep Your Cabbage Soup Fresh
- Fridge: Store leftovers in an airtight container for up to 4 days.
- Freezer: Portion into freezer-safe containers and freeze for up to 3 months.
- Reheat: Thaw overnight in the fridge, then reheat gently on the stove with a splash of broth or water to revive that perfect texture.
FAQs
Can I make this in a slow cooker?
Yes! Brown the beef first, then add everything to your crockpot. Cook on low for 6–7 hours or high for 3–4.
Can I use ground turkey or chicken instead of beef?
Absolutely. The flavor will be lighter, but just as comforting.
How can I make it vegetarian?
Swap the beef for lentils or plant-based meat and use vegetable broth instead.
Is this recipe gluten-free?
Yes — as long as you check your seasonings and broth for hidden gluten.
Conclusion
This Cabbage Soup with Ground Beef Recipe is proof that comfort food doesn’t have to be complicated. It’s the kind of meal that feels like a warm blanket after a long day — nourishing, flavorful, and made with love.
So grab that cabbage sitting in your fridge, roll up your sleeves, and make a pot of this goodness tonight. And if you do, tag me on social — I’d love to see your creation!
Visit our Pinterest for regular slow cooker recipe updates, or join our Facebook discussions where cooking fans exchange their favorite hearty meal ideas.
Print
Cabbage Soup with Ground Beef Recipe – The Best Comfort Meal Ever
- Total Time: 1 hour
- Yield: 8 servings 1x
Description
This hearty cabbage soup with ground beef is a cozy, flavor-packed dish that brings warmth to the table with every spoonful. Loaded with vegetables, tender meat, and savory broth, it’s the perfect comfort food for any day of the week.
Ingredients
- 1 small yellow onion, diced
- 1 small green bell pepper, diced
- 2 carrots, sliced
- 2 ribs celery, sliced
- 4 garlic cloves, minced
- 1 pound ground beef (or substitute with ground chicken, turkey, or venison)
- 2 tablespoons garlic and herb seasoning
- 1 teaspoon Cajun seasoning (optional, for a spicy kick)
- 2 tablespoons tomato paste
- 2 medium russet potatoes, peeled and chopped into bite-sized cubes
- 2 (14.5 oz) cans diced tomatoes (preferably with basil, garlic, and oregano)
- 1 head green cabbage, chopped
- 1 heaping tablespoon Knorr beef bouillon mixed with 4 cups of water (or use 4 cups of beef or chicken broth)
- Salt and freshly ground black pepper, to taste
Instructions
1. Place a Dutch oven or large heavy-bottomed pot over medium heat. Add the ground beef and cook thoroughly, breaking it apart with a spoon, until browned and no longer pink.
2. Add the diced onion, green bell pepper, carrots, and celery to the pot. Sprinkle in the garlic and herb seasoning, Cajun seasoning (if using), and a pinch of freshly cracked black pepper. Sauté until vegetables begin to soften and release their aroma.
3. Stir in the tomato paste and cook for another 2 to 3 minutes, letting the paste caramelize slightly to enhance its flavor.
4. Add the cubed potatoes and stir them through the vegetable and beef mixture. Pour in both cans of diced tomatoes and scatter the minced garlic over the top. Mix well.
5. Gradually add the chopped cabbage, folding it into the mixture in stages to help it fit into the pot as it wilts.
6. Pour in the prepared bouillon mixture or broth. Stir the soup well to combine all ingredients evenly. Increase heat and bring to a rolling boil.
7. Once boiling, reduce heat to low, cover, and simmer gently for around 30 minutes, until potatoes are fork-tender and cabbage is soft.
8. Taste and adjust seasoning with salt and pepper. Ladle into bowls and serve hot.
Notes
Use your preferred ground protein—beef, turkey, chicken, or venison all work well.
Add the cabbage gradually to avoid overflow, allowing it to wilt as you stir it in.
For more depth of flavor, use diced tomatoes with herbs and let the tomato paste cook until slightly caramelized.
This soup stores well in the fridge for up to 4 days and tastes even better the next day.
- Prep Time: 15 minutes
- Cook Time: 45 minutes
- Category: Main Course
- Method: Stovetop
- Cuisine: American
Nutrition
- Serving Size: 1 serving
- Calories: 350




